舒兰盆地位于佳伊地堑中南段,伊通盆地东北部,是北东向展布的一个狭长状断陷盆地,前人仅对舒兰盆地开展过初步的地质调查,但对盆地构造特征、演化过程的研究相对薄弱。综合区域地质资料、孢粉资料等,分析对比了舒兰盆地与伊通盆地的新生代沉积地层;通过电法、地震剖面解析,认为盆地南段为半地堑式构造特征,中段为地堑式构造特征,盆地北段从西北至东南呈阶梯状加深的构造形态;结合钻井资料分析认为,盆地基底岩性南段以上二叠统杨家沟组为主,中段主要由花岗岩和白垩系组成,北段主要由白垩系组成;综合分析认为,舒兰盆地构造演化可划分为3个构造演化阶段,即初始断陷期(古新世早期)、断陷期(古新世—渐新世)和挤压反转期(渐新世—中新世)。
The Shulan Basin is located in the middle-southern section of Jiayi Graben and northeast of Yitong Basin. It is a narrow-length faulted basin distributed in the north-east direction. Previously, only preliminary geological surveys were conducted on the Shulan Basin. However, The study of the characteristics and evolution process is relatively weak. Based on the comprehensive regional geological data and sporopollen data, the Cenozoic sedimentary strata of Shulan Basin and Yitong Basin are analyzed and compared. By electrical method and seismic section analysis, the southern section of the basin is considered as half-graben structural features and the middle section is the graben According to analysis of drilling data, it is considered that the Upper Permian Yangjiagou Formation in the southern part of the basement lithology of the basin is mainly composed of granite and Cretaceous , And the northern segment is mainly composed of Cretaceous. According to the comprehensive analysis, the tectonic evolution of the Shulan Basin can be divided into three tectonic evolution stages, that is, the initial fault depression period (early Paleocene), fault depression period (Paleocene-Oligocene) ) And compression inversion period (Oligocene - Miocene).
